About 9 Aspasia Close
9 Aspasia Close is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in St Albans (AL1 5HQ).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. At 74 m² this is the 3rd smallest of 10 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 72–100 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(November 2022) shows a C (score 75), near the top of the C band. When first surveyed in August 2011 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good.
Last changed hands 10 years ago, in January 2016. Across 2007–2016,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£346,000 is 21.4% above the 2016 sale price.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2026.
